In a word.... YES. I have the Griggs front coilovers on my car & on my next mustang I would never go back to conventional springs up front. The rears aren't really needed, unless you're hardcore tracking it. My setup is Koni yellows all around, Griggs front coilovers, Hypercoil springs and Maximum C/C plates. You won't regret it if you go with them.
